Dirty Work...

This week’s been largely dominated by digging. We’ve done so much of it that I’m a little disappointed not to have unearthed a few fossils. Thankfully, with the help of our now exhausted Italian WWOOFer Jacopo, we’ve come on leaps and bounds in the space of a few days. Sadly he could only stay with us for a week before heading back to the real world in search of paid employment (and a few days’ rest), but with four more beds sown, two more well on the way, a batch of pumpkins and potatoes planted, two chook domes moved and the wallaby defences shored up, he should be more than satisfied with his contribution. Grazie infinite!
